    Who among the following were well known as champions of women's education in colonial India?
    (1) Sister Subbalaksmi
    (2) Begum Rokeya Sakhawat Hossain
    (3) Keshub Chandra Sen
    (4) Ananda Coomaraswamy

    A)  1, 2, 3 and 4    

    B)  1, 2 and 3 only

    C)  3 and 4 only    

    D)  1 and 2 only

    Correct Answer: B

    Solution :

    [b] Rokeya Sakhawat Hossain was a Muslim feminist and social reformer who dedicated her life to education and the empowerment of women. In 1916, she founded the Muslim Women's Association, an organization that argued for women's education and employment. In 1926, Rokeya presided over the Bengal Women's Education Conference held in Calcutta, the first noted attempt to bring women together in support of women's education rights. She was active in debates and conferences concerning the advancement of women. Sister Subhalakshmi was a dauntless savior of the neglected and socially marginal, widow community of India. All her life, she unflinchingly claimed the fundamental rights for women and the necessary improvement in the status of widow, particularly in the Madras Presidency of British India. Kesab Chandra Sen is well known for women education. Women's education was one of Keshab's greatest concern. Ananda Kentish Coomaraswamy (1877-1947) was one of the great art historians of the twentieth century whose multifaceted writings deal primarily with visual art, aesthetics, literature and language, folklore, mythology, religion, and metaphysics.
